Why a Rear Dash Cam is No Longer an Optional Extra

While front-facing dash cams are common, many drivers overlook the importance of monitoring what happens behind them. Rear-end collisions are one of the most frequent types of accidents on UK roads. Without a rear camera, proving the other driver was at fault can be difficult. A rear dash cam provides irrefutable evidence in these situations, protecting your no-claims bonus and preventing drawn-out disputes with insurers.

Furthermore, a rear camera is invaluable for capturing evidence of tailgating, parking lot bumps, and 'crash for cash' scams where a driver brake-checks you intentionally. It offers 360-degree peace of mind, ensuring you have a complete record of any event unfolding around your vehicle.

Key Specifications to Look For in a Rear Dash Cam

Not all rear cameras are created equal. To ensure your investment provides genuine security, focus on the specs that deliver clear and usable footage.

1. Video Resolution: Clarity is King

The primary purpose of a dash cam is to record events clearly. For a rear camera, this means being able to decipher number plates and other vital details.

• Full HD (1080p): This should be the minimum resolution you consider. It provides sufficient detail for most daytime conditions and is a significant step up from older 720p models.

• 4K Resolution: While less common for rear cameras, a 4K sensor offers the ultimate in clarity, making it easier to identify details from a distance or when zooming in on recorded footage.

2. Field of View (FOV): See the Bigger Picture

The field of view determines how much of the scene behind you the camera can capture. A narrow FOV might miss crucial action happening in adjacent lanes.

• Look for 120-150 degrees: This range is the sweet spot for a rear camera. It's wide enough to cover multiple lanes of a motorway without causing significant 'fisheye' distortion at the edges of the video. 3. Low-Light Performance and Night Vision

Accidents don't just happen in broad daylight. Your rear dash cam must be able to perform effectively at night, in tunnels, or during overcast weather.

• Wide Dynamic Range (WDR): This technology helps balance the light and dark areas in the frame, preventing number plates from being washed out by other cars' headlights at night.

• Image Sensor: Look for cameras that use high-quality sensors (like those from Sony STARVIS), which are specifically designed for excellent low-light performance.

The Importance of a Complete Car Camera Front and Rear System

While a standalone rear camera is useful, its true potential is unlocked when integrated into a dual-camera system. A proper car camera front and rear setup records simultaneously, providing a synchronised, all-encompassing view of any incident. This is vital for complex situations where action may be happening at both ends of your vehicle.

Modern systems often feature a single power source and one memory card for both cameras, making installation and management far simpler than running two separate devices.

Other Features That Add Value

Beyond the core specs, several other features can enhance the functionality of your rear dash cam.

• Parking Mode: This feature allows the dash cam to monitor for impacts even when your car is parked and the engine is off. It requires the camera to be hardwired to the car's battery but provides invaluable protection against hit-and-runs in car parks.

• G-Sensor: An integrated G-sensor detects sudden shocks, such as a collision, and automatically locks the video file to prevent it from being accidentally overwritten by the loop recording feature.

• Loop Recording: This is a standard feature that continuously records footage, overwriting the oldest files as the memory card fills up. This ensures your camera is always recording without you needing to manually manage storage.

• Discreet Design: A small, unobtrusive rear camera is less likely to attract the attention of thieves and won't obstruct your rear view.
